Why Dot Day Matters: More Than Just Dots
Dot Day, celebrated annually on September 15th, is far more than just a fun activity. It's a global celebration of creativity, inspired by Peter H. Reynolds's acclaimed children's book, The Dot. This simple story, about a girl who discovers her artistic talent through a single dot, has resonated with millions, proving the power of self-belief and encouraging creative expression in individuals of all ages. Dot Day printables play a vital role in making this celebration accessible and engaging. They provide readily available resources that extend the book's message beyond the pages, fostering a culture of creativity within classrooms, homes, and communities. The act of creating with dots encourages experimentation, self-discovery, and the understanding that everyone possesses creative potential. The celebration encourages the sharing of art and inspires others to participate, creating a worldwide community united by creativity.

Exploring the Key Aspects of Dot Day Printables
1. Definition and Core Concepts: Dot Day printables are digital resources readily available online, designed to enhance the Dot Day celebration. They range from simple dot templates for drawing and coloring to more complex activity sheets, coloring pages, and even lesson plan templates. These resources aim to extend the message of The Dot and provide accessible tools for encouraging creativity.
2. Applications Across Industries: While primarily used in educational settings (schools, preschools, homeschooling), Dot Day printables have broader applications. Art therapists utilize dot-based activities for therapeutic purposes. Businesses might use dot-themed materials for team-building exercises focusing on collaboration and creative problem-solving. Even personal use, for journaling, mindfulness exercises, or simple creative expression, is readily supported by the abundance of free resources.
3. Challenges and Solutions: One potential challenge is finding high-quality, well-designed printables. The internet offers a vast array of resources, but quality can vary. Another challenge is adapting printables for different age groups and skill levels. Solutions include carefully selecting reputable websites, looking for printables with clear instructions and age recommendations, and modifying or customizing printables to suit individual needs. Consider the size and complexity of the dot patterns, the type of paper used, and the range of coloring tools provided.
4. Impact on Innovation: The very nature of Dot Day and its associated printables encourages innovative thinking. The simple act of using dots as a starting point for art invites experimentation and exploration. Children are not limited to replicating pre-existing designs; instead, they are empowered to create their own unique expressions. This fosters a mindset of innovation and self-belief in one’s creativity.

Further Analysis: Examining the Impact on Different Age Groups
The impact of Dot Day printables varies depending on the age group. For younger children (preschool – early elementary), simple dot-to-dot activities, large-dot coloring pages, and basic dot-based pattern creation are ideal. These activities enhance fine motor skills, color recognition, and hand-eye coordination while fostering creativity. Older children (upper elementary – middle school) can benefit from more complex printables involving intricate dot patterns, creating their own dot-based artwork inspired by nature, using dots to create geometric designs, or even exploring the mathematical concepts behind tessellations and patterns using dots. High school students can engage in more sophisticated projects, like exploring dot-based art styles, creating digital art using dot-based techniques, or integrating dots into other art forms such as collage or mixed media.
FAQ Section: Answering Common Questions About Dot Day Printables
-
Q: Where can I find free Dot Day printables? A: Many websites, educational blogs, and teacher resource sites offer free Dot Day printables. A simple web search for "Dot Day printables" will yield numerous results. However, always review the source for quality and appropriateness.
-
Q: Are Dot Day printables only for children? A: No, Dot Day printables can be enjoyed by people of all ages. The simplicity of the dot as a creative element allows for adaptation to various skill levels and creative interests.
-
Q: How can I adapt Dot Day printables for students with special needs? A: Adapt printables by modifying the size of the dots, the complexity of the patterns, or the type of paper used. Consider offering alternative mediums for creative expression, such as paint, textured papers, or digital tools. Focus on the process and the joy of creation rather than the final product.
-
Q: What materials do I need to use Dot Day printables? A: The necessary materials depend on the printable. Generally, you will need printer paper, crayons, colored pencils, markers, or paint. Consider adding other materials for a more textured experience, like glitter glue, stamps, or collage elements.
Practical Tips: Maximizing the Benefits of Dot Day Printables
-
Choose Age-Appropriate Printables: Select printables that match the skill level and interests of your target audience.
-
Encourage Experimentation: Don’t limit children to simply coloring within the lines. Encourage them to explore different colors, techniques, and creative interpretations.
-
Integrate with Other Activities: Combine Dot Day printables with storytelling, writing prompts, or other creative activities to enhance the learning experience.
-
Showcase and Celebrate: Create a display area to showcase the completed artwork. This fosters a sense of accomplishment and encourages further creative exploration.
